As the population of wolves increases, their prey decrease. This is most directly followed by which of the following? a sustained period of high numbers in the wolf population a sustained period of high numbers in the rabbit population a decrease in the wolf population a steady decrease in caterpillars

The answer, I believe, would be C) A decrease in the wolf population - because the prey decreases, fewer wolves will be able to find food, which will lead to a decrease in their population.
